Top species in this area

  • Experience

    The spot hosts a variety of fish like striped bass and crappie, providing a rich fishing experience. While diverse and family-friendly, the lack of detailed infrastructure like boat ramps could limit certain activities.

  • Tips

    Use live bait to increase catch rates for bass and catfish. Avoid fishing during high precipitation and consider bank fishing due to missing boat ramp info.

  • Fishing seasons

    Predominantly mild wind speeds during the summer and fall make for ideal fishing, although winter precipitation can negatively impact conditions. The seasonal temperature ranges moderately from 49°F in January to 84°F in July.
